Class JPAProcessorFactory

java.lang.Object
com.sap.olingo.jpa.processor.core.processor.JPAProcessorFactory

public final class JPAProcessorFactory extends Object
  • Constructor Details

    • JPAProcessorFactory

      public JPAProcessorFactory(org.apache.olingo.server.api.OData odata, org.apache.olingo.server.api.ServiceMetadata serviceMetadata, JPAODataCRUDContextAccess context)
  • Method Details

    • createCUDRequestProcessor

      public JPACUDRequestProcessor createCUDRequestProcessor(org.apache.olingo.server.api.uri.UriInfo uriInfo, org.apache.olingo.commons.api.format.ContentType responseFormat, JPAODataRequestContextAccess context, Map<String,​List<String>> header) throws org.apache.olingo.commons.api.ex.ODataException
      Throws:
      org.apache.olingo.commons.api.ex.ODataException
    • createCUDRequestProcessor

      public JPACUDRequestProcessor createCUDRequestProcessor(org.apache.olingo.server.api.uri.UriInfo uriInfo, JPAODataRequestContextAccess context) throws org.apache.olingo.commons.api.ex.ODataException
      Throws:
      org.apache.olingo.commons.api.ex.ODataException
    • createActionProcessor

      public JPAActionRequestProcessor createActionProcessor(org.apache.olingo.server.api.uri.UriInfo uriInfo, org.apache.olingo.commons.api.format.ContentType responseFormat, Map<String,​List<String>> header, JPAODataRequestContextAccess context) throws org.apache.olingo.commons.api.ex.ODataException
      Throws:
      org.apache.olingo.commons.api.ex.ODataException
    • createProcessor

      public JPARequestProcessor createProcessor(org.apache.olingo.server.api.uri.UriInfo uriInfo, org.apache.olingo.commons.api.format.ContentType responseFormat, Map<String,​List<String>> header, JPAODataRequestContextAccess context) throws org.apache.olingo.commons.api.ex.ODataException
      Throws:
      org.apache.olingo.commons.api.ex.ODataException